Our client, a pioneering force in the Aviation industry, is seeking a highly skilled Senior Aerospace Engineer specializing in Avionics Systems. This is a fully remote position, offering the flexibility to contribute your expertise from anywhere. You will be at the forefront of designing, developing, and integrating advanced avionics systems for next-generation aircraft. This role demands a deep understanding of aerospace principles, complex systems engineering, and a passion for innovation in aviation technology.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Lead the design, development, testing, and integration of complex avionics systems, including navigation, communication, flight control, and mission systems.
  • Define system requirements, specifications, and architecture for avionics components and sub-systems.
  • Perform detailed analysis, simulations, and performance evaluations of avionics hardware and software.
  • Collaborate closely with cross-functional engineering teams (e.g., structures, propulsion, software) to ensure seamless integration of avionics systems.
  • Develop and execute verification and validation plans to ensure compliance with stringent aerospace standards and regulations (e.g., DO-178C, DO-254).
  • Troubleshoot and resolve complex technical issues related to avionics systems throughout the product lifecycle.
  • Contribute to the development of technical documentation, including design documents, test procedures, and reports.
  • Mentor junior engineers and provide technical guidance on avionics-related projects.
  • Stay abreast of the latest advancements in avionics technology, including AI, cybersecurity in aviation, and advanced sensor integration.
Qualifications:
  • A Bachelor's or Master's degree in Aerospace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or a related field.
  • A minimum of 8 years of progressive experience in aerospace engineering, with a strong focus on avionics systems design and development.
  • Proven expertise in systems engineering principles and processes within the aerospace industry.
  • In-depth knowledge of avionics standards, certification requirements, and industry best practices.
  • Experience with simulation tools (e.g., MATLAB/Simulink) and modeling techniques.
  • Proficiency in relevant programming languages (e.g., C/C++, Ada) and hardware description languages (e.g., VHDL/Verilog) is a plus.
  • Excellent problem-solving, analytical, and communication skills.
  • Ability to work effectively in a remote, collaborative team environment and manage multiple tasks simultaneously.

Our client, a leader in the aerospace industry, is seeking a skilled Aerospace Systems Engineer specializing in Avionics to join their dedicated team based in Leicester, Leicestershire, UK . This role is crucial for the development and integration of cutting-edge avionics systems for next-generation aircraft. You will be involved in the entire lifecycle of avionics systems, from concept design and requirements definition through to integration, testing, and certification. The successful candidate will possess a strong understanding of avionics hardware and software, communication protocols, and system architecture. You will collaborate closely with cross-functional teams, including software developers, hardware engineers, and test pilots, to ensure the successful implementation and performance of avionic systems. This is a fantastic opportunity to work on exciting projects within a collaborative and innovative environment.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Define and manage system-level requirements for avionics systems.
  • Develop system architecture and design specifications for avionics components.
  • Integrate avionics hardware and software components into aircraft systems.
  • Conduct system testing, verification, and validation activities.
  • Troubleshoot and resolve issues related to avionics system performance.
  • Liaise with suppliers and external partners on avionics technology development.
  • Prepare technical documentation, including design reports, test plans, and user manuals.
  • Ensure compliance with aerospace standards (e.g., DO-178C, DO-254).
  • Support flight testing and operational deployment of avionics systems.
  • Contribute to continuous improvement initiatives within the engineering team.
Qualifications:
  • Degree in Aerospace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, or a related field.
  • Minimum of 5 years' experience in aerospace systems or avionics engineering.
  • Strong understanding of avionics systems, communication protocols (e.g., ARINC 429, CAN bus), and aircraft architectures.
  • Experience with systems engineering V-model and related tools.
  • Familiarity with aerospace certification processes.
  •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ills for effective team collaboration.
  • Proficiency in relevant simulation and analysis tools.
